The Role

Lush Fresh Handmade Cosmetics is seeking a Creative Producer for our in-house Film and Photo team, positioned within our Brand department. Reporting to the Film and Photo Manager, you will be responsible for producing high-quality and original content across all Lush platforms, including website ecommerce photo and video, social content, event activations and brand documentaries. You will do this in partnership with the Film and Photo Manager and our in house Photographer and Videographer.

The Creative Producer oversees film and photo projects from start to finish, ensuring they run smoothly and seamlessly, while reporting on progress to stakeholders. You have a diverse range of photo and video experience and a deep knowledge of the full production pipeline. You are adept at creating budgets and schedules and enjoy collaborating with stakeholders to take a brief from paper to screen whilst keeping costs and time in check. You like to get hands on with production; helping to build sets, source props and ensuring the studio runs smoothly.

This is an excellent opportunity to work as part of the Brand team at Lush, working with a lot of caring and creative people, to promote products that make a difference.

Reporting to the Film & Photo Manager, the Creative Producer's core RESPONSIBILITIES will include:

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ee all aspects of Film and Photo production including the coordination of the production team, talent and other personnel in partnership with project managers
  • Create and manage detailed schedules for all team deliverables
  • Ensure that budgets and project plans are clear and realistic, requesting additional budget if the scope of the creative requires it and/or discussing with the Film & Photo team if restricted
  • Communicate with all project partners and stakeholders to ensure that expectations are aligned and clearly documented
  • Work creatively with the team to ensure look and feel aligns to the brief and art direction getting hands on as needed
  • Select and communicate with external vendors, freelance talent, and in house models to discuss availability and rates, and manage them on set
  • Collaborate with global teams as needed, in particular for YouTube content or Global Events
  • Manage talent and location contracts. Work with the Legal team to ensure production is executed safely for all parties involved
  • Ensure that insurance, health and safety rules, copyright laws and agreements are followed.
  • Maintain data privacy expectations in partnership with our data protection team
  • Coordinate all Film & Photo spends. Ensure all freelancers are paid in timely manner and correct paperwork is delivered to Finance
  • Maintain Film and Photo studio logistics including the inventory database of product and props, ordering, sourcing, and donating items as needed. This includes management of new product as it arrives to studio
  • Ensure assets being uploaded in post production align to DAM standards for keywording, tagging and delivery
  • Oversee the internal model database, sending out casting calls and ensuring hours are logged and payment is made
  • Support and coordinate on projects using external production companies
  • Travel to photoshoot locations as required, sometimes at short notice, generally once or twice per quarter but sometimes more
